A+Technical Description
This CNC lathe features a robust 10-inch chuck and a 3-inch bar capacity, making it well-suited for a wide range of turning applications. Designed with four axes, it enables advanced machining capabilities, including milling, drilling, and tapping, thanks to integrated live tooling. The machine is powered by a 30 HP motor, delivering strong performance and reliability for demanding production environments. It achieves a maximum spindle speed of 3,400 RPM, ensuring efficient material removal and high-quality surface finishes. The turning diameter is 12 inches, with a swing of 31.75 inches, allowing for the machining of larger workpieces. The maximum machining length is 21 inches, providing ample space for extended parts. The absence of a tailstock streamlines the setup for bar-fed operations, focusing on high-volume production. The CNC control system is a Haas control, known for its intuitive interface, ease of programming, and seamless integration with modern manufacturing workflows. This lathe is ideal for shops requiring precision, versatility, and productivity in turning operations, especially in industries such as automotive, aerospace, and general manufacturing. Its combination of power, axis count, and live tooling support makes it a flexible solution for complex and multi-tasking machining needs.
